Research Abstract |
In this research, we showed that 25-hydroxyvitamin D[ 25(OH) D] itself has biological effects. The effects of 25(OH) D did not require its activation to 1, 25-dihydroxyvitamin D[ 1, 25(OH)_2D]. Our results suggested that 25(OH) D directly activates vitamin D receptor(VDR). Moreover, 25(OH) D modulated the functions of lipid raft.
